Women’s Basketball Holds off Vikings in Conference Home Opener

DULUTH, Minn. – The St. Scholastica women's basketball team was able to outlast Bethany Lutheran College on Friday night at Reif Gymnasium, winning 66-58 in the Upper Midwest Athletic Conference (UMAC) home opener.

The Saints (4-8, 1-1 UMAC) used a pair of 6-0 runs in the first seven minutes to open up a 15-7 lead. Later in the half, CSS went on a 12-4 run to take its biggest lead of the game at 29-15. The Vikings (5-7, 1-1 UMAC) responded by going on a 7-0 run to cut the margin to seven, but the Saints still went into halftime with a 31-22 edge.

St. Scholastica shot 37-percent in the first half and held Bethany Lutheran to 23-percent shooting. The Saints forced 11 BLC turnovers, which led to 15 points. #Taylor Fellbaum# had 11 first-half points.

The Saints maintained their lead for the first six minutes of the second half until the Vikings went on a 6-0 run to tie the game at 41-41 with 10 minutes to go. BLC then briefly took a one-point lead with eight minutes left, but the Saints took it right back on a #Caitlin McKernon# layup on the proceeding possession.

CSS lengthened its lead back to eight and went 7-for-8 from the free throw line in the final minute to defeat the Vikings 66-58.

The Saints shot 38-percent for the game, while holding the Vikings to 33-percent. BLC went 0-for-7 from beyond the arc for the game. CSS committed a season-low 12 turnovers.

Taylor Fellbaum (Minong, Wis./Northwood HS) and Caitlin McKernon (Coon Rapids, Minn./Fridley HS) each had season-highs of 13 points to lead the Saints. #Erin Morstad# recorded 10 points, five assists, and five rebounds for a good all-around effort in just her second game this season. #Laura Amys# and #Bri Allen# each had six rebounds to lead the team. Nicole Jones and Jessica Englund each had double-doubles with each scoring 18 points.
